Performance for Gamers and Movie Enthusiasts
Gaming on this TV was an absolute treat. The 144Hz Game Mode Pro is no gimmick. I played a few rounds of fast-paced shooters and noticed how the Variable Refresh Rate (48Hz to 144Hz) kept the experience buttery smooth. There was no screen tearing, and the input lag was negligible. For movies, the Dolby Vision HDR made dark scenes in thrillers pop with detail, while action sequences felt immersive thanks to the Multi-Channel Surround Sound system. It was surprising how much the 2.0.2 sound setup filled the room without needing a separate soundbar.

Competing Products
When comparing the Hisense CanvasTV to Samsung’s The Frame TV, both aim to double as aesthetic pieces of art. The Hisense, however, stands out with its Hi-Matte Display, which handles glare better than Samsung’s offering. On the other hand, LG’s OLED TVs deliver superior contrast and black levels, but they lack the artistic features and customizable frames that make the CanvasTV unique. I also considered Sony’s Bravia XR, which excels in AI-powered picture processing, but the 144Hz refresh rate and Art Mode on the Hisense provided a more well-rounded experience for my needs.
